				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://thearcofdelco.org/wp-content/uploads/2013/01/stephanie_kent.jpg"><img src="http://thearcofdelco.org/wp-content/uploads/2013/01/stephanie_kent.jpg" alt="stephanie_kent" width="200" height="285" class="alignleft size-full wp-image-680" /></a>Stephanie Kent works as the IM4Q Coordinator at The Arc of Delaware County.  She was born and raised in Glenolden, Pennsylvania with extensive volunteer work for The Arc of Delaware County throughout her high school and college years.  Stephanie Kent graduated from The Pennsylvania State University-Berks College, located in Reading, PA, with a B.A. in Applied Psychology.  She has extensive undergraduate internship experience with school-aged childe with intellectual and developmental disability as well has mental health issues.  While interning, Ms. Kent implemented a school-wide “Anti-Bullying” system in one of the elementary schools part of the Reading School District.  She has an uncle with and Intellectual and Developmental Disability who has lived with her and her family for over 10 years.  She is familiar with what it takes to care for a family member with an Intellectual and Developmental Disability.  Stephanie currently resides in Wallingford, Pennsylvania with he parents, uncle, and brother who will soon graduate from Syracuse University.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Arc’s Legislative Affairs Committee held forum for local legislators and updated them on issues, including:</p>
<p>1.  BUDGET: The  care and protection of people with intellectual and</p>
<p>developmental disabilities is a core responsibility of government.</p>
<p>2.  REFORM SPECIAL EDUCATION FUNDING: One of every seven   students is educated under special education rules, and $1 billion in state funds is spent annually on special education.</p>
<p>3.  STATE INSTITUTIONS: The General Assembly embraced the shift from state institutions to community-based services when it passed the MH/MR act of 1966.</p>
<p>4.  MARRIAGE LICENSE: PA Domestic Relations Code (23Pa.C.S. 1302[b]) establishes requirements for the issuance of marriage licenses. Current law gives local county official discretion to deny marriage     licenses to people they believe to be “incompetent.”</p>
<p>5.  PLACE “BURDEN OF PROOF” ONTO SCHOOL DISTRICTS, NOT PARENTS: The US Supreme Court decision in Schaffer vs. Weast  determined that, unless state rules indicate otherwise, the party “seeking relief” has the burden of proof in IDEA due process              proceedings.</p>
<p>6.  IMPROVE SCHOOL CLIMATE FOR STUDENTS WITH DISABILITIES: For many students with disabilities across PA, the school day is filled with challenges above and beyond those of their disability.</p>
<p>7.  EMPLOYMENT: People with disabilities have historically had difficulty getting and maintaining jobs in the community. As a result, they tend to live below the poverty level and be dependent on government programs to survive.</p>
<p>8.  ODP COMMUNITY SYSTEM MANAGEMENT: Significant changes in the way the community system assesses individuals’ need, authorizes services, and pays community service providers has created significant angst and concern among individuals who rely pm  community services, their families and advocates, and those who provide the services.</p>

<p>Susan Shapiro, anchor: A lawsuit is being filed against Governor Tom Corbett over proposed budget cuts. The services for Pennsylvania residents with disabilities. News 8’s Matt Barcaro is live in Harrisburg with more on the lawsuit.</p>
<p>Matt Barcaro, reporting:: Here it is, this was just filed today by mental health groups and different constituents in Pennsylvania. They say they’ve never actually filed a suit against the governor before for proposing cuts like this in the Department of Public Welfare budget but they fear they have to or thousands of Pennsylvanians who rely on those services will suffer. The mental health groups allege the Governor’s proposed 20 percent cut to the Department’s budget is way too deep and it violates the state’s requirement to adequately fund those services. They believe that this will hurt people with mental and behavioral disabilities the most and it will take away their safety net. The Governor has said time and time again that this has been a tough budget year and there must be cuts made but the state’s Disability Rights Network thinks it will actually end up costing taxpayers more.</p>
<p>Mark Murphy, Disability Rights Network: You cut community-based services for people with intellectual disabilities and mental illness – you don’t save money. What you do is you force them into higher cost services. People’s needs don’t change.</p>
<p>Matt Barcaro: You might be wondering why this is happening now, after all, the budget is still a proposal – nothing’s been passed yet – but the mental health groups think that even the Governor’s proposal of these cuts violates the law and they want to make sure that the cuts don’t become law.</p>

<p>The Arc of Delaware County has recently joined the new Eastern Delaware County Consortium on Inclusive Recreation as the ‘lead agency’ for the Collaborative Consortium. The Consortium is made up of organizations and individuals who promote the concept of inclusive recreation in Eastern Delaware County in a manner that will increase inclusive opportunities in schools and communities for people with disabilities.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Premise Alert System is a statewide program that allows families of those with developmental disabilities or special needs, like autism or dementia, to file a form with local police.</p>
<p>“By alerting local police about a person’s unique needs, the police and emergency responders will be better able to address an emergency where the resident might have a medical condition or a physical or mental limitation that would require special attention,” said council Chairman Jack Whelan.</p>
